Monarchs Shut out Pirates in VIP Cup Finale

April 12, 2014 - American Hockey League (AHL)
Portland Pirates News Release


Manchester, NH - The Manchester Monarchs shut out the Pirates in their second straight meeting, defeating Portland 4-0 on Saturday night.

Manchester scored on a fluke goal in the first period. After two Pirates penalties left Portland at a 5 on 3 disadvantage, Linden Vey put a shot on the Pirates net that bounced over Justin Hache's shoulder and past Louis Domingue to give the Monarchs the opening goal.

Manchester added two more goals in the second period. Vey tallied his second of the night with 10:49 left in the second and Jordan Weal added a goal with 3:19 left in the second. Brayden McNabb added a goal for Manchester in the 3rd period, beating Domingue, who was run over on the play. Domingue made 35 saves on the night in the defeat, while Jean-Francois Berube made 17 save in the shutout for Manchester.

Manchester finishes the 2013-14 VIP Cup Series, presented by VIP Tires and Service, with the VIP Cup championship and a 9-3 advantage in games this season. The VIP Player of the Series will be announced after the season and can be voted on at www.vip-cup.com.
